Two feared drowned, after a group of friends went for a swim in Juhu beach in Mumbai, the police said.

A group of five, all residents of Juhu Koliwada area, went to the beach at around 12:30 pm for a swim, an official from Santa Cruz police station said.

Lifeguards and fire brigade personnel warned them against entering the sea, chief fire officer Prabhat Rahangadale said.

The youngsters, however, went to a different spot away from the main beach and ventured into the sea. They started drowning soon, he said.

Three of them were rescued by lifeguards, while there was no trace of two others, Rahangadale said.

According to police, those feared drowned were identified as Rajendra Chowdhury (20) and Sameer Sheikh (18).
